PROPERTIES: 5-(tert-butyl) 2-ethyl 3-bromo-7,8-dihydro-4H-pyrazolo[1,5-a][1,4]diazepine-2,5(6H)-dicarboxylate is a brominated diesterified heterocycle with a molecular weight of 394.30 g/mol. This off-white crystalline solid has a melting point between 105-108 C. The molecule features a pyrazolo[1,5-a][1,4]diazepine ring system with dihydro substitution at positions 7 and 8, a bromo substituent at position 3, a tert-butyl ester at position 5, and an ethyl ester at position 2. It demonstrates limited solubility in common organic solvents such as ethyl acetate and methanol but is sparingly soluble in water. APPLICATIONS: This compound primarily functions as a synthetic intermediate in the production of pharmaceuticals and specialty chemicals, where the brominated diesterified pyrazolodiazepine structure provides versatile sites for cross-coupling and nucleophilic substitution reactions. In medicinal chemistry, it has been employed in developing antiparasitic agents targeting protozoan infections and has shown utility in creating kinase inhibitors for cancer therapy. The pyrazolodiazepine-dicarboxylate structure has also been explored in materials science for developing nonlinear optical materials, leveraging the polarizable bromine atom and ester groups to enhance optical properties.
